Jay Z and Marina Abramović

Jay Z continues to set new rules. The hip-hop mastermind presents the performance art film for “Picasso Baby,” the Timbaland-produced single off his No. 1 album Magna Carta…Holy Grail. The 10-minute film, directed by Mark Romanek, premiered on HBO earlier this evening.

The Roc Nation mogul shot the visuals at Pace Gallery in New York last month. Spectators including Wale, Taraji P. Henson, Rosie Perez, Judd Apatow, Alan Cumming, Magazeen, Fab 5 Freddy, and the “grandmother of performance art” Marina Abramović gathered around as he took turns interacting with them in the all-white space.

“Concerts are pretty much performance art,” explains Jay, who shot a video for “Holy Grail” with Justin Timberlake in L.A. this week. “In a smaller venue, it’s a bit more intimate so you feel the energy of the people.”
